Emberledger records every points accrual and redemption as an append-only ledger entry; never mutate rows directly, as the nightly reconciler in Tallowgate depends on immutability. Redemptions over 50k points route through the manual-review queue — check it daily until the auto-approval work lands. Marisol owns the fraud heuristics; coordinate with her before touching scoring thresholds. Backfills must run in idempotent batches of 500. The reconciler and the API both load their runtime configuration from the block that follows.

service settings:
[silwyn]
host = silwyn.crelvogrid.internal
user = silwyn_svc
database = silwyn_prod

Ticket: Config drift in CharsetScout encoding detection. Summary for newer folks: CharsetScout sniffs the encoding of uploaded text files before ingestion. Last week's audit found the detection nodes in the east cluster running different confidence thresholds and fallback encodings than what's in the repo, which explains the inconsistent mojibake reports. Someone hand-edited the hosts during an incident and never backported the change. We need to decide which side wins. The values actually found on the drifted nodes are below.

settings of tagef-bawif:
DRUIX_HOST=druix.zemvarlabs.internal
DRUIX_PORT=8000

Welcome, plugin authors. The Corvane rate-parity checker compares published room rates across connected channels and flags mismatches beyond a configurable tolerance. Your plugin supplies normalized rate snapshots; Corvane handles currency conversion, tax harmonization, and scoring. Please validate snapshots against the schema before submission, as malformed payloads are silently dropped. The full schema reference and submission workflow are documented on the internal page here.

operations page: https://jira.qorvelsys.internal/browse/pages/browse/pages